The Ju Ware Narcissus Basin(汝窯天青無紋橢圓水仙盆)


In all the displays of National Palace Museum, I like Ju Ware Narcissus Basin(汝窯天青無紋橢圓水仙盆) the most. It dose not as famous as Jadeite Cabbage or Meat-shaped Stone but I think it is the most beautiful masterpiece in National Palace Museum.

There is a legend that an emperor said to his liegeman about the most wonderful color of the glaze “the color of glaze should be as the sky after the rain stops and the clouds have broken through ” (雨過天青雲破處,者般顏色作將來). I think the Ju Ware Narcissus Basin’s color is conform to what the emperor had described because the Ju Ware Narcissus Basin’s color is so like the color of sky after rains, and there is no any cracks on it, so level and smooth, so glassy it is!

In ancient China, there is four principles to described a perfect china “ as blue as the sky, as bright as the mirror, and as thin as the paper.” I think the Ju Ware Narcissus Basin matches all the principles, so I think it is the best china in the world, that is way I like it so much

A Painting A Story

At November 1,2007, I went to the Museum Of World Religions(世界宗教博物館),there had a very special exhibition, a exhibition about a painting, it displays just a painting. I think it is a very good way to introduce this painting more clearly to viewers. It is a painting about the birth of Jesus Christ, called (Adoration of Shepherds【牧羊人朝拜聖嬰】), the painter is Luca Giordano(路卡˙喬丹奴).
For the thousand years the stories of the Bible were very good subjects for artists. The artists in different ages had different styles, Luca Giordano kept the main point on the change of light, so he put a light from the top of the sky to the mother and the baby, it made the viewers saw them in the first sight. All the people and animals surround by the baby and the mother made them looked holy and inviolable. In this exhibition, tell us almost every things about this painting, I thought it was better than display many painting in one exhibition because viewers can learn more deeply about this painting, not just think these paintings are beautiful.
